Create the indoor jungle of your dreams with the help of these stylish raised pots.
If you’re the proud owner of a growing plant collection, you’ll know how difficult it can be to find the space to display all your leafy friends.
Most homes will only have a limited number of surfaces – think shelves, coffee tables, windowsills and kitchen countertops – and while some statement plants will be fine popped on the floor, most plants tend to look a bit lost when left at ground level.
That’s where raised plant pots – or plant pots with stands – come in. Not only are they a great way to transform smaller plants into a statement feature, but they’re also handy for keeping your plants out of harm’s way (ideal if you’ve got children and/or pets running around) and ensuring they’re in the perfect spot for their light and humidity needs. They’re also a great way to make small plants stand out on a surface, especially if they’re surrounded by larger ones.
